#eb2cd2 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#eb2cd2 is composed of 92.2% red, 17.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 10.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 307.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#eb2cd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#d700a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#eb2cd2 color description : Bright magenta.

The hexadecimal color #eb2cd2 has RGB values of R:235, G:44,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.11,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15412434.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040004 is the darkest color, while #fef1f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928590 is the less saturated color, while #fd1adf is the most saturated one.
